Are you ready to lead enforcement, compliance, and service delivery within our Food and Health & Safety team? As an Operational Team Leader, you will support the existing team leader in managing our food hygiene and safety standards inspection programme, investigating complaints, and overseeing enforcement actions to ensure businesses comply with regulations.
Reporting into the Public Protection Manager, you will play a key role in ensuring effective enforcement and compliance across one of four specialist teams—Environmental Health (Environmental Protection), Environmental Health (Food & Health and Safety), Licensing, or Trading Standards. You will oversee team management, service delivery, and regulatory enforcement, ensuring high standards for businesses and communities.

Your role as Team Leader:-
  • Managing the Food and H&S team, ensuring effective service delivery and regulatory compliance and leading the food hygiene inspection programme, handling complaints and enforcing compliance.
  • Overseeing health & safety investigations, workplace accident reviews, and infectious disease control.
  • Providing expert advice on complex cases, guiding the team in decision-making and enforcement strategies.
  • Conducting 1:1s, HR functions, and performance reviews to ensure team development and efficiency.
  • Managing statutory contracts, budgets, and external service providers to optimise service delivery.
  • Supporting officers attending court, leading prosecutions, and ensuring enforcement cases reach successful conclusions.
  • Work with elected Members, agencies, businesses, and regulatory bodies to build strong partnerships.
  • Conduct site visits, assisting officers in inspections and enforcement actions when needed.
Your previous experience as Team Leader:-
  • Proven leadership experience within public protection services and overseeing multi-disciplinary operations.
  • Strong knowledge of statutory duties, compliance, and regulatory enforcement.
  • Experience in delivering successful programmes and projects from inception to completion.
  • Effective stakeholder engagement, working with government bodies, law enforcement, and businesses.
  • Ability to manage reports, briefings, and technical documentation to support operational strategy.
  • Knowledge of Health & Safety enforcement, workplace regulations, and compliance procedures.
  • Strong understanding of food standards, regulatory frameworks, and legal enforcement.
  • Experience managing multi-disciplinary enforcement caseloads with strategic oversight.
  • Proficiency in IT systems, including MS Office and case management tools.
  • A full driving licence, enabling site visits as required.
Qualifications:-
  • Relevant qualifications in Environmental Health, Licensing, or Trading Standards.
  • Post-qualification experience and competency under the Food Law Code of Practice
  • Professional memberships (where applicable) and regulatory certifications.
  • Strong proficiency in ICT and mobile working tools.
  • Understanding of health and safety, safeguarding, and confidentiality standards.
